Extras, from VCI's website:
So the documentary and Q & A are new. It's all-region too.
Director & Writer Commentary, Daniel Griffith Documentary, Q&A with Larry Drake, Tonya Crowe & J. D. Feigelson, CBS Network World Premiere Promo, Rebroadcast Promo, Behind the Scenes Photo Gallery

A bit more info on the documentary:
Featuring interviews with director FRANK DE FELITTA, screenwriter J. D. FEIGELSON, actor LARRY DRAKE, actress TONYA CROWE, actor ROBERT LYONS, unit production manager BOB KOSTER, location manager KOOL MARDER, director/fan STUART GORDON, Horrorhound co-founder AARON CROWELL, and more! Produced and directed by DANIEL GRIFFITH. A BALLYHOO MOTION PICTURES production.
